1// Package defaults of commonly used options parsed from environment.2// Check ResetWith for details.3package defaults4import (5 "flag"6 "log"7 "os"8 "regexp"9 "strconv"10 "strings"11 "time"12 "github.com/go-rod/rod/lib/utils"13)14// Trace is the default of rod.Browser.Trace .15// Option name is "trace".16var Trace bool17// Slow is the default of rod.Browser.Slowmotion .18// The format is same as https://golang.org/pkg/time/#ParseDuration19// Option name is "slow".20var Slow time.Duration21// Monitor is the default of rod.Browser.ServeMonitor .22// Option name is "monitor".23var Monitor string24// Show is the default of launcher.Launcher.Headless .25// Option name is "show".26var Show bool27// Devtools is the default of launcher.Launcher.Devtools .28// Option name is "devtools".29var Devtools bool30// Dir is the default of launcher.Launcher.UserDataDir .31// Option name is "dir".32var Dir string33// Port is the default of launcher.Launcher.RemoteDebuggingPort .34// Option name is "port".35var Port string36// Bin is the default of launcher.Launcher.Bin .37// Option name is "bin".38var Bin string39// Proxy is the default of launcher.Launcher.Proxy40// Option name is "proxy".41var Proxy string42// LockPort is the default of launcher.Browser.LockPort43// Option name is "lock".44var LockPort int45// URL is the default websocket url for remote control a browser.46// Option name is "url".47var URL string48// CDP is the default of cdp.Client.Logger49// Option name is "cdp".50var CDP utils.Logger51// Reset all flags to their init values.52func Reset() {53 Trace = false54 Slow = 055 Monitor = ""56 Show = false57 Devtools = false58 Dir = ""59 Port = "0"60 Bin = ""61 Proxy = ""62 LockPort = 297863 URL = ""64 CDP = utils.LoggerQuiet65}66var envParsers = map[string]func(string){67 "trace": func(string) {68 Trace = true69 },70 "slow": func(v string) {71 var err error72 Slow, err = time.ParseDuration(v)73 if err != nil {74 msg := "invalid value for \"slow\": " + err.Error() +75 " (learn format from https://golang.org/pkg/time/#ParseDuration)"76 panic(msg)77 }78 },79 "monitor": func(v string) {80 Monitor = ":0"81 if v != "" {82 Monitor = v83 }84 },85 "show": func(string) {86 Show = true87 },88 "devtools": func(string) {89 Devtools = true90 },91 "dir": func(v string) {92 Dir = v93 },94 "port": func(v string) {95 Port = v96 },97 "bin": func(v string) {98 Bin = v99 },100 "proxy": func(v string) {101 Proxy = v102 },103 "lock": func(v string) {104 i, err := strconv.ParseInt(v, 10, 32)105 if err == nil {106 LockPort = int(i)107 }108 },109 "url": func(v string) {110 URL = v111 },112 "cdp": func(v string) {113 CDP = log.New(log.Writer(), "[cdp] ", log.LstdFlags)114 },115}116// Parse the flags117func init() {118 ResetWith("")119}120// ResetWith options and "-rod" command line flag.121// It will be called in an init() , so you don't have to call it manually.122// It will try to load the cli flag "-rod" and then the options, the later override the former.123// If you want to disable the global cli argument flag, set env DISABLE_ROD_FLAG.124// Values are separated by commas, key and value are separated by "=". For example:125//126// go run main.go -rod=show127// go run main.go -rod show,trace,slow=1s,monitor128// go run main.go --rod="slow=1s,dir=path/has /space,monitor=:9223"129//130func ResetWith(options string) {131 Reset()132 if _, has := os.LookupEnv("DISABLE_ROD_FLAG"); !has {133 if !flag.Parsed() {134 flag.String("rod", "", `Set the default value of options used by rod.`)135 }136 parseFlag(os.Args)137 }138 parse(options)139}140func parseFlag(args []string) {141 reg := regexp.MustCompile(`^--?rod$`)142 regEq := regexp.MustCompile(`^--?rod=(.*)$`)143 opts := ""144 for i, arg := range args {...
